Customizing GA4 for Journalistic Content Strategy

Google Analytics 4 (GA4) can be customized to track key journalistic metrics like article engagement, reader retention, traffic sources for news content, and search behavior on your site, using custom reports, explorations, segments, and events.

Core Customization Methods in GA4

GA4 offers three main tools for tailoring reports to content performance:

  • Library for Custom Reports: Access via Reports > Library to edit standard reports (e.g., Acquisition, Engagement), create new ones from templates or scratch, add dimensions/metrics, apply filters, and organize into collections/topics for sidebar visibility.
  • Explorations: Build advanced analyses for user paths, segments (e.g., new vs. returning readers), and behavior comparisons beyond standard reports.
  • Looker Studio: Connect GA4 data for visualizations like dashboards tracking content metrics across articles.

Up to 150 custom reports per property; editors/administrators can modify detail reports.

Key Steps to Create Custom Reports

  1. Go to Reports > Library > Create new report (detail or overview).
  2. Select template (e.g., Traffic acquisition) or blank; add dimensions (e.g., Page path, Search term, Traffic source, Device category) and metrics (e.g., Event count, Total users, Engagement time, Bounce rate).
  3. Apply filters (e.g., Hostname = news.yoursite.com, Event name = view_search_results for site search terms).
  4. Customize visualization (tables, charts); save, add to collection (e.g., custom "Content" topic), and publish.
  5. From existing reports: Click Customize report in top-right to adjust directly.

Journalism-Specific Customizations

Tailor reports to measure content strategy success, such as reader loyalty, viral sharing, and topic performance:

  • Content Engagement Report: Dimensions: Page title/path + and, Engagement time; Metrics: Average engagement time, Event count (e.g., scroll depth, time on page). Filter for article paths (e.g., /articles/*). Reveals top-performing stories and drop-off points.
  • Traffic Sources for News: Dimensions: Session medium/source (e.g., social, email newsletters); Metrics: Sessions, Conversions (e.g., newsletter signups). Identifies channels driving readership.
  • Site Search Analysis: Dimension: Search term; Metrics: Event count, Total users; Filter: Event name = view_search_results. Uncovers reader interests (e.g., popular topics like "election coverage").
  • Audience Segmentation: Create segments for new/returning users, device type, or geography; add custom dimensions (e.g., article category via events). Track behavior like returning readers' preferred content types.
  • Custom Events for Journalists: Set up events for article shares, comments, video views, or downloads without coding. Include in reports for granular insights (e.g., CTA clicks on bylines).
Report Type Key Dimensions Key Metrics Use for Journalism
Content Performance Page title, Path Engagement time, Bounce rate Identify high-retention articles
Acquisition Session source/medium Sessions, Users Optimize promo channels (e.g., Twitter for breaking news)
Search Terms Search term Event count Discover trending topics
User Behavior User type, Device Event count per user Segment loyal vs. casual readers

Advanced Tips

  • Custom Dimensions/Metrics: Register via Admin > Custom definitions (e.g., "article_category") for deeper segmentation like "politics" vs. "sports" performance.
  • Filters/Segments: Refine for mobile readers or specific campaigns; compare new vs. returning users.
  • Integrate with Content Tools: Use Looker Studio for dashboards combining GA4 with CMS data (e.g., WordPress views).
  • Monitor limitations: GA4 emphasizes events over sessions; test filters to avoid data gaps.

These setups enable data-driven decisions, like prioritizing investigative pieces with high engagement or A/B testing headlines.
